    SENSE-SEAT: challenging disruptions in shared workspaces through a sensor-based SEAT

    Creative industries’ workers are becoming more prominent as countries move towards intellectual-based economies. Consequently, the workplace needs to be reconfigured so that creativity and productivity can be better promoted at shared workspaces. We report on a study based on diaries, interviews and probes, with 8 creative industries’ profes sionals at a co-working space, with the goal of understand ing their advantages and disadvantages, and causes for cognitive disruptions. Findings indicate that temperature, noise and coworkers’ requests are the main causes for dis ruptions in the work processes. The insights are used to inform the design process of SENSE-SEAT, a seat with em bedded sensors and tangible actuators, as a contribution to reimagining the role of tangible and embedded interac tion in intelligent furniture. We are currently at a prototyping stage, with 3D prints and 3D renders and we explain the design process and outlining the early results.info:eu-repo/semantics/publishedVersio

    Atomistic Insight into the Role of Threonine 127 in the Functional Mechanism of Channelrhodopsin-2

    Channelrhodopsins (ChRs) belong to the unique class of light-gated ion channels. The structure of channelrhodopsin-2 from Chlamydomonas reinhardtii (CrChR2) has been resolved, but the mechanistic link between light-induced isomerization of the chromophore retinal and channel gating remains elusive. Replacements of residues C128 and D156 (DC gate) resulted in drastic effects in channel closure. T127 is localized close to the retinal Schiff base and links the DC gate to the Schiff base. The homologous residue in bacteriorhodopsin (T89) has been shown to be crucial for the visible absorption maximum and dark–light adaptation, suggesting an interaction with the retinylidene chromophore, but the replacement had little effect on photocycle kinetics and proton pumping activity. Here, we show that the T127A and T127S variants of CrChR2 leave the visible absorption maximum unaffected. We inferred from hybrid quantum mechanics/molecular mechanics (QM/MM) calculations and resonance Raman spectroscopy that the hydroxylic side chain of T127 is hydrogen-bonded to E123 and the latter is hydrogen-bonded to the retinal Schiff base. The C=N–H vibration of the Schiff base in the T127A variant was 1674 cm−1, the highest among all rhodopsins reported to date. We also found heterogeneity in the Schiff base ground state vibrational properties due to different rotamer conformations of E123. The photoreaction of T127A is characterized by a long-lived P2380 state during which the Schiff base is deprotonated. The conservative replacement of T127S hardly affected the photocycle kinetics. Thus, we inferred that the hydroxyl group at position 127 is part of the proton transfer pathway from D156 to the Schiff base during rise of the P3530 intermediate. This finding provides molecular reasons for the evolutionary conservation of the chemically homologous residues threonine, serine, and cysteine at this position in all channelrhodopsins known so far

    Volunteer-based IT Helpdesks as Ambiguous Quasi-Public Services:A Case Study from Two Nordic Countries

    In this case study we take a Nordic perspective on the tension between increased digitalisation of public services and the insufficient support for citizens with limited digital literacy. Volunteer-based IT helpdesk services in public libraries have emerged as an attempt to address this tension. Drawing on examples of volunteering in public library-based IT helpdesk services in two Nordic countries, this paper considers the IT helpdesks as quasi-public services. Based on interviews, observations and workshops, we explore: the work of IT helpdesk volunteers, the characteristics of helpdesk services offered, and the implications of these services being offered by volunteers. The services offered are of acceptable quality to the users while the ambiguity and lack of institutional support is making the service fragile. In spite of the challenges of the quasi-public IT helpdesk service we also note how it offers a potential platform for the co-design and support of new public services.     The economics of debt clearing mechanisms

    We examine the evolution of decentralized clearinghouse mechanisms from the 13th to the 18th century; in particular, we explore the clearing of non- or limitedtradable debts like bills of exchange. We construct a theoretical model of these clearinghouse mechanisms, similar to the models in the theoretical matching literature, and show that specific decentralized multilateral clearing algorithms known as rescontre, skontrieren or virement des parties used by merchants were efficient in specific historical contexts. We can explain both the evolutionary self-organizing emergence of late medieval and early modern fairs, and its robustness during the 17th and 18th century
